Trump's Action Neutralizes Labor Board Amid Declining Union Membership

President Trump's removal of a National Labor Relations Board member on January 27th effectively neutralized the board's ability to resolve labor disputes, coinciding with a report showing slightly decreased union membership in 2024 despite a rise in public approval of unions.

US Senate Blocks Sanctions on International Criminal Court

The US Senate blocked legislation that would have sanctioned the International Criminal Court (ICC) over its arrest warrants for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and other officials, with a 54-45 vote failing to reach the required 60 votes; the bill had previously passed the House.

Trump Administration's Spending Freeze Blocks Medicaid Payments in Multiple States

The Trump administration's freeze on federal spending has blocked Medicaid payments in multiple states, impacting hospitals, doctors, and millions of patients. The White House claims no payments have been affected, but several states report disruptions. Legal challenges are underway.
